stream_socket_server() 和 socket_create()

abcde123456

众所周知 PHP 原生支持的 socket 有 stream_socket_server() 和 socket_create() 两种方式
 
我看了下workerman的代码 上面用的是 stream_socket_server 方式创建 且不需安装拓展
$this->_mainSocket = stream_socket_server($local_socket, $errno, $errmsg, $flags, $this->_context);
 
但是socket_create这个函数创建的代码貌似更加底层 性能上差异大不大

2168 1 0
1个回答

th

一般来说是越高级越快,但估计都感觉不出来。

  • 7csn 2019-08-29

    不是越高级封装越多,越慢吗?

  • th 2019-08-29

    封装是用低级语言封装的,封装的越多你写的代码就越少,总体来看是快了

年代过于久远,无法发表回答
🔝